I've had Lear caps on my last two F150s and they are one of the best makers, at least they were when I bought the last one in 2006. Only problem I ever had was the push button latch on the rear window, after several years road salt got into it and the key lock seized up.

Nope. Don't know anyone in particular. Just know Elkhart, IN is the RV capitol of the country and several manufacturers of truck caps, tonneau covers, truck, van, etc., accessories are located there, besides all of the major RV manufacturers. It's easy access from I-90 (Indiana East-West Tollroad) as it cuts right across Elkhart County in northern Indiana.

I have had both ARE and Leer caps in the past and both were excellent.
However in Oct 2021 I bought a new Leer cap for my 2018 Silverado and had to have the dealer send it back to the factory due to a large gap on each side of the rear door.
The gap was so large that you could pull the door open even though the latches were closed. After an almost 6 month wait the replacement cap came in and had the same issue but not as bad. I should have refused the cap and got a refund and bought another ARE, however I let it slide and still regret it.
At the time the dealer said the manufacturers were having lots of quality issues due to large turnover of employees during Covid.
